In this video, we explore how self-love and affirmations act as core mechanisms for nervous system repair during trauma recovery. Trauma is not just a memory; it is held in the body's nervous system, impacting the balance between your fight/flight and rest/digest responses. By practicing intentional self-love and gentle self-talk, you can send repeated signals of safety to your brain, which helps lower cortisol, increase oxytocin, and rebuild internal trust.

We provide specific, trauma-informed affirmations designed to support you through various emotional states:

• Safety and Grounding: Using phrases like "I am safe right now" to anchor yourself in the present moment.

• Permission to Rest: Overcoming the "inner critic" and the survival-based belief that rest is unsafe.

• Navigating Difficult Emotions: Learning to witness thoughts of anger, grief, or numbness without judgment.

• Creative Expression: Understanding how non-verbal activities like art or movement can bypass the self-critic to foster healing.

By utilizing the principles of neuroplasticity, these affirmations help reshape neural pathways that have been strengthened by fear, moving your system toward a state of regulation and hope. We also discuss how integrating somatic movement, mindfulness, and time in nature can further recalibrate your nervous system.
